"Late Night with Carl Sagan" is this intriguing documentary that feels almost like a love letter to Sagan's original *Cosmos*. The use of an iPhone for filming, along with those homemade props, gives it this raw, intimate vibe. It's not flashy but rather grounded, which adds to its charm. The frame-by-frame animation feels like a labor of love, drawing you in with its quaintness. The tone is both poetic and existential, touching on big themes about humanity's role in the universe, and there's something hopeful that resonates throughout. It’s an insomniac's dream, a sort of midnight contemplation that lingers long after it ends – definitely a curious piece for any collector interested in thoughtful, unconventional filmmaking.
